Creamy Fettuccine with Sriracha Sauce

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Total Time: 40 minutes
Cook Time: 30 Minutes
Yield: 4 Servings
Spicy, flavorful, comfort food at its best. We love this easy and elegant pasta meal. Perfect for a quick weekday meal or weekend entertaining. This recipe is made easy and delicious with La Terra Fina Sriracha Three Cheese Dip & Spread.

Ingredients

  • 2 T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 ounces diced pancetta (optional)
  • 4 small mild fresh red chilies (such as Fresno chiles), sliced
  • 1, 28-ounce can diced tomatoes
  • 3/4 cup Sriracha Three Cheese Dip & Spread
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 12 ounces fettuccine pasta

Instructions

  1. In a large skillet over medium heat, warm oil. Add pancetta, if using, and cook, stirring occasionally, until almost crisp, about 3 minutes.
  2. Add chilies and cook, stirring occasionally, until pancetta is crisped and chiles are just beginning to soften, about 1 minute.
  3. Stir in tomatoes and bring to a boil. Reduce to simmer. Cook, stirring occasionally, until sauce thickens, about 15 minutes.
  4. Stir in dip, and salt and pepper to taste; remove from heat, cover and set aside.
  5. About 5 minutes before sauce is done, cook pasta according to package directions. Drain, transfer to skillet with sauce and gently toss to coat. Serve hot.

Chef’s Notes: If you can’t find mild red chiles, substitute jalapeños or a diced red bell peppers. You can also substitute bacon for pancetta.
